About Phyllis Court Club

Phyllis Courtis a private members club situated in a grand riverside manor,set in 18 acres of land with 17 guest bedrooms on the River Thames in Henley-On-Thames and spectacular views over the river & the countryside beyond.

Phyllis Court has excellent facilities, superb cuisines and wines, relaxing riverside accommodation and friendly staff being the perfect setting to meet friends & colleagues, with the highlight of the year being Henley Regatta.

The Role

Working closely with the Food and Beverage Manager and Assistant Manager, you will be responsible for overseeing the Food and Beverage operations across the Club, with a primary focus on the planning and delivery of banqueting and events. This will include weddings, birthdays, anniversaries, Christmas parties, summer parties, and any other events requested by our Members.

Working alongside and supporting the Food and Beverage Assistants, you will ensure the service and standards are maintained to the highest levels for our Members, delivering exceptional and seamless experiences across all events and service areas. During quieter event periods, you will also support the wider Food and Beverage operation, assisting within the restaurants and bars to ensure consistency of service across the Club.

Responsibilities will include

  • Oversee all Foodand Beverage Events
  • Possess extensive knowledge of food & beverage, ability to recall menus and ingredients to inform customers and waiting staff.
  • Conduct briefings before service to ensure staff are briefed on menu specials or changes, dietary requirements, special occasions etc.
  • Ensure on the job training for Food and Beverage Assistants is conducted on a regular basis and in line with the Club standards.
  • Ensure cashing up is done correctly and in accordance with company policy.
  • Cover Duty Manager shifts on a rotational basis.
